溫馨提示×

Debian Kafka權限設置要注意什么

小樊
54
2025-03-30 08:45:38
欄目: 智能運維

在Debian上設置Kafka權限時,有幾個關鍵點需要注意:

使用Ranger插件進行權限控制

  • 安裝和配置Ranger插件:需要解壓縮Ranger插件包,修改install.properties配置文件,包括插件安裝位置、Ranger服務端地址、Kafka服務名稱等。完成配置后,執行enable-kafka-plugin.sh腳本,將必要的配置文件和jar包拷貝到Kafka安裝目錄。

配置文件加載失敗問題

  • 如果在配置操作后重啟服務,可能會遇到配置文件加載失敗的問題,例如找不到資源文件。需要檢查配置文件路徑是否正確,并確保所有必要的資源文件都已正確放置。

使用ACLs進行消息權限控制

  • 創建用戶和用戶組:使用Kafka管理工具(如kafka-topics.sh、kafka-users.sh等)創建用戶和用戶組。
  • 分配權限:為用戶和用戶組分配特定的權限,可以細粒度地控制對主題、分區、集群等資源的訪問。
  • 配置授權器:在Kafka配置文件(如server.properties)中配置授權器,例如security.authorization.class.name。
  • 啟用安全認證:使用SSL/TLS加密通信和SASL身份驗證,需要在Kafka配置文件中啟用安全認證。
  • 驗證權限:使用Kafka管理工具驗證用戶或用戶組是否擁有預期的權限。

常見問題及解決方法

  • 配置文件加載失敗:確保所有配置文件路徑正確,并且Kafka服務器有足夠的權限訪問這些文件。
  • 權限問題:在Linux上部署Kafka時,創建新的用戶和組用于運行Kafka進程,更改Kafka目錄的所有權,并修改Kafka配置文件以使用新創建的用戶和組。

以上就是在Debian上設置Kafka權限時需要注意的幾個關鍵點。確保遵循這些步驟和建議,可以幫助您有效地管理Kafka的權限,提高系統的安全性和穩定性。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女